Description
Deliciously crispy and evenly cooked bacon made effortlessly in an air fryer, perfect for a quick breakfast or adding to your favorite dishes without the mess of stovetop frying.

Ingredients
- ½ pound thin-cut or regular bacon (see notes for thick-cut bacon)
Instructions
- Preheat Air Fryer: Preheat your air fryer on the hottest setting for 5 minutes to ensure even cooking.
- Arrange Bacon: Carefully place a single layer of bacon slices in the hot air fryer basket. For a 5.5 quart basket, 6-8 slices fit depending on their size.
- Air Fry Bacon: Cook the bacon at 350°F for 5 minutes initially. Then, flip each slice and cook for an additional 2-4 minutes at 350°F, checking regularly during the second cooking period to reach your desired level of crispiness.
- Clean Between Batches: If preparing multiple batches, drain the grease from the air fryer drip tray and thoroughly wipe off all grease from the basket and tray between batches to prevent smoke buildup.
Notes
- For thick-cut bacon, increase cooking time and check frequently to avoid burning.
- Cooking times may vary slightly depending on the thickness of bacon and air fryer model.
- Always monitor bacon in final cooking stages to achieve your preferred crispness.
- Draining grease between batches prevents smoking and keeps your air fryer clean.
